Abstract

Let GG be a connected reductive algebraic group with simply connected derived subgroup. Over the complex numbers there exists a local method to study the geometric properties of a point gg in the closure of a Jordan class of GG in terms of Jordan classes of a maximal rank reductive subgroup MGM \leq G depending on the point gg, and further to the closures of certain decomposition classes in Lie(MM). We adapt this method to the case of an algebraically closed field of characteristic pp, and we give sufficient restrictions on pp for it to hold.
